Comparison 1. Resistance testing (RT) versus no RT.
Outcome or subgroup title | No. of studies | No. of participants | Statistical method | Effect size |
---|---|---|---|---|
1 Mortality | 5 | 1140 | Odds Ratio (M‐H, Random, 95% CI) | 0.89 [0.36, 2.22] |
2 Virological failure | 10 | 1728 | Odds Ratio (M‐H, Random, 95% CI) | 0.70 [0.56, 0.87] |
3 Change in CD4 cell count | 7 | 1349 | Mean Difference (IV, Random, 95% CI) | 1.00 [‐12.49, 10.50] |
4 Progression to AIDS | 3 | 809 | Odds Ratio (M‐H, Random, 95% CI) | 0.64 [0.31, 1.29] |
5 Adverse events | 4 | 808 | Odds Ratio (M‐H, Random, 95% CI) | 0.89 [0.51, 1.55] |
6 Change in viral load | 10 | 1837 | Mean Difference (IV, Random, 95% CI) | ‐0.23 [‐0.35, ‐0.11] |
